Rock And Roll Band
This is not as embarrassing as coming out of the closet and saying that my favorite album of all time is "Abbas-greatest hits"..... it's not.....honestly, but the first record, cassette tape, and CD that I totally dug, and continued to replace throughout the years, was Boston's 1976 self titled album, "Boston"
I love reggae, punk, funk, ska, grunge, jazz, the blues, alternative/underground, jam bands(the Dead/Phish), bluegrass, anything from the 60's, hardcore metal, maybe a little classical, even a country song or two as long as it dosn't whine me to death, but hearing "More than a Feeling" and "Rock and Roll Band" by Boston gives me that old, "Man, high school is one big awesome party" kind of feeling.
Those basic, American rock and roll songs, by a band who had bigger afro's than any Motown group, backdropped our nights of sneaking out till 3AM, and our days of playing Frisbee in Walnut Grove Park next to the high school where we were supposed to be going to class.
Those were the days....Boston was my band.
